Change android makefile to build webrtc for android/x86 as well
Review URL: http://webrtc-codereview.appspot.com/68002 git-svn-id: http://webrtc.googlecode.com/svn/trunk@208 4adac7df-926f-26a2-2b94-8c16560cd09d
This commit is contained in:
parent
3c0a86f83d
commit
43ea04236b
@ -16,9 +16,9 @@ LOCAL_MODULE_TAGS := optional
|
|||||||
LOCAL_GENERATED_SOURCES :=
|
LOCAL_GENERATED_SOURCES :=
|
||||||
LOCAL_SRC_FILES := \
|
LOCAL_SRC_FILES := \
|
||||||
echo_cancellation.c \
|
echo_cancellation.c \
|
||||||
|
resampler.c \
|
||||||
aec_core.c \
|
aec_core.c \
|
||||||
aec_rdft.c \
|
aec_rdft.c
|
||||||
resampler.c
|
|
||||||
|
|
||||||
# Flags passed to both C and C++ files.
|
# Flags passed to both C and C++ files.
|
||||||
MY_CFLAGS :=
|
MY_CFLAGS :=
|
||||||
@ -27,9 +27,16 @@ MY_DEFS := '-DNO_TCMALLOC' \
|
|||||||
'-DNO_HEAPCHECKER' \
|
'-DNO_HEAPCHECKER' \
|
||||||
'-DWEBRTC_TARGET_PC' \
|
'-DWEBRTC_TARGET_PC' \
|
||||||
'-DWEBRTC_LINUX' \
|
'-DWEBRTC_LINUX' \
|
||||||
'-DWEBRTC_THREAD_RR' \
|
'-DWEBRTC_THREAD_RR'
|
||||||
|
ifeq ($(TARGET_ARCH),arm)
|
||||||
|
MY_DEFS += \
|
||||||
'-DWEBRTC_ANDROID' \
|
'-DWEBRTC_ANDROID' \
|
||||||
'-DANDROID'
|
'-DANDROID'
|
||||||
|
else
|
||||||
|
LOCAL_SRC_FILES += \
|
||||||
|
aec_core_sse2.c \
|
||||||
|
aec_rdft_sse2.c
|
||||||
|
endif
|
||||||
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
||||||
|
|
||||||
# Include paths placed before CFLAGS/CPPFLAGS
|
# Include paths placed before CFLAGS/CPPFLAGS
|
||||||
|
@ -25,9 +25,12 @@ MY_DEFS := '-DNO_TCMALLOC' \
|
|||||||
'-DNO_HEAPCHECKER' \
|
'-DNO_HEAPCHECKER' \
|
||||||
'-DWEBRTC_TARGET_PC' \
|
'-DWEBRTC_TARGET_PC' \
|
||||||
'-DWEBRTC_LINUX' \
|
'-DWEBRTC_LINUX' \
|
||||||
'-DWEBRTC_THREAD_RR' \
|
'-DWEBRTC_THREAD_RR'
|
||||||
|
ifeq ($(TARGET_ARCH),arm)
|
||||||
|
MY_DEFS += \
|
||||||
'-DWEBRTC_ANDROID' \
|
'-DWEBRTC_ANDROID' \
|
||||||
'-DANDROID'
|
'-DANDROID'
|
||||||
|
endif
|
||||||
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
||||||
|
|
||||||
# Include paths placed before CFLAGS/CPPFLAGS
|
# Include paths placed before CFLAGS/CPPFLAGS
|
||||||
|
@ -19,9 +19,12 @@ MY_DEFS := '-DNO_TCMALLOC' \
|
|||||||
'-DNO_HEAPCHECKER' \
|
'-DNO_HEAPCHECKER' \
|
||||||
'-DWEBRTC_TARGET_PC' \
|
'-DWEBRTC_TARGET_PC' \
|
||||||
'-DWEBRTC_LINUX' \
|
'-DWEBRTC_LINUX' \
|
||||||
'-DWEBRTC_THREAD_RR' \
|
'-DWEBRTC_THREAD_RR'
|
||||||
|
ifeq ($(TARGET_ARCH),arm)
|
||||||
|
MY_DEFS += \
|
||||||
'-DWEBRTC_ANDROID' \
|
'-DWEBRTC_ANDROID' \
|
||||||
'-DANDROID'
|
'-DANDROID'
|
||||||
|
endif
|
||||||
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
||||||
|
|
||||||
# Include paths placed before CFLAGS/CPPFLAGS
|
# Include paths placed before CFLAGS/CPPFLAGS
|
||||||
|
@ -35,11 +35,14 @@ MY_DEFS := '-DNO_TCMALLOC' \
|
|||||||
'-DWEBRTC_TARGET_PC' \
|
'-DWEBRTC_TARGET_PC' \
|
||||||
'-DWEBRTC_LINUX' \
|
'-DWEBRTC_LINUX' \
|
||||||
'-DWEBRTC_THREAD_RR' \
|
'-DWEBRTC_THREAD_RR' \
|
||||||
'-DWEBRTC_ANDROID' \
|
|
||||||
'-DANDROID' \
|
|
||||||
'-DWEBRTC_NS_FIXED'
|
'-DWEBRTC_NS_FIXED'
|
||||||
# floating point
|
# floating point
|
||||||
# -DWEBRTC_NS_FLOAT'
|
# -DWEBRTC_NS_FLOAT'
|
||||||
|
ifeq ($(TARGET_ARCH),arm)
|
||||||
|
MY_DEFS += \
|
||||||
|
'-DWEBRTC_ANDROID' \
|
||||||
|
'-DANDROID'
|
||||||
|
endif
|
||||||
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
||||||
|
|
||||||
# Include paths placed before CFLAGS/CPPFLAGS
|
# Include paths placed before CFLAGS/CPPFLAGS
|
||||||
|
@ -22,10 +22,12 @@ MY_DEFS := '-DNO_TCMALLOC' \
|
|||||||
'-DNO_HEAPCHECKER' \
|
'-DNO_HEAPCHECKER' \
|
||||||
'-DWEBRTC_TARGET_PC' \
|
'-DWEBRTC_TARGET_PC' \
|
||||||
'-DWEBRTC_LINUX' \
|
'-DWEBRTC_LINUX' \
|
||||||
'-DWEBRTC_THREAD_RR' \
|
'-DWEBRTC_THREAD_RR'
|
||||||
|
ifeq ($(TARGET_ARCH),arm)
|
||||||
|
MY_DEFS += \
|
||||||
'-DWEBRTC_ANDROID' \
|
'-DWEBRTC_ANDROID' \
|
||||||
'-DANDROID'
|
'-DANDROID'
|
||||||
|
endif
|
||||||
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
LOCAL_CFLAGS := $(MY_CFLAGS_C) $(MY_CFLAGS) $(MY_DEFS)
|
||||||
|
|
||||||
# Include paths placed before CFLAGS/CPPFLAGS
|
# Include paths placed before CFLAGS/CPPFLAGS
|
||||||
|
Loading…
Reference in New Issue
Block a user